Lakewood Cultural Center Presents
World-renowned, maverick organist, Cameron Carpenter
Friday, February 2, 2024 at 7:30 p.m.
The spring season kicks off with a true virtuoso composer and performer, Cameron Carpenter, who is known worldwide for his fearless interpretations of the classics and is the first organist to ever be nominated for a Grammy Award for a solo album.
The Los Angeles Times states, “Carpenter is one of the rare musicians who changes the game of his instrument… He is a smasher of cultural and classical music taboos. He is technically the most accomplished organist I have ever witnessed… And, most important of all, the most musical.”
A graduate of New York’s famous Julliard School, Carpenter has spent nearly two decades mesmerizing audiences with his uniquely contemporary style of playing such a traditional instrument. Audience members whose familiarity with the range of an organ from hearing it used in church services will be radically surprised by what Carpenter can do with it.
“Carpenter is a ground-breaking organist, and we’re thrilled to have him in Lakewood this season,” said Lakewood Cultural Center Administrator Rita Sommers, Cultural Center administrator. For his Lakewood performance, Carpenter will be drawing from the works of Johann Sebastian Bach, a figure whose compositions have played a critical role in Carpenter’s musical evolution.” The Lakewood concert will include “The Goldberg Variations,” one of the ultimate keyboard challenges.
